What is Backbone.js?
Backbone.js is a lightweight JavaScript library that gives structure to web applications by providing models with key-value binding and custom events. It also offers collections with a rich API of enumerable functions, views with declarative event handling, and connects it all to your existing API over a RESTful JSON interface.
It is not a full-fledged framework like Angular or React, but rather a library that offers the building blocks for developing web applications. This makes it ideal for developers who want more control over their app’s architecture without being locked into an opinionated framework.
Why Choose Backbone.js Development?
Backbone.js has several benefits that make it a preferred choice for developers and businesses alike. Here are some of the core advantages:
1. Simplicity and Lightweight Architecture
Backbone.js is intentionally minimalistic. It doesn’t force developers into rigid structures and gives them the flexibility to choose the components they want to use. With just one dependency (Underscore.js), it keeps the application lean and efficient.
2. Clear MVC Pattern
Backbone.js supports the Model-View-Controller (MVC) design pattern, which helps in separating business logic from UI logic. This separation makes code more modular, easier to manage, and simplifies debugging and testing.
3. Improved Code Organization
One of the standout features of Backbone.js development is its ability to keep code well-structured. Models, views, routers, and collections allow for a modular development approach, making it easy to scale applications without turning them into a tangled mess of code.
4. RESTful API Integration
Backbone.js communicates seamlessly with RESTful APIs, which makes it a great choice for developing SPAs. The synchronization between models and the server ensures that the client-side UI stays updated with the backend data without complex boilerplate code.
5. Flexibility and Extensibility
Unlike other opinionated frameworks, Backbone.js doesn’t impose a specific architecture. Developers can integrate it with other libraries or tools such as React, jQuery, or even modern state management solutions.
6. Event-Driven Communication
The event-driven architecture in Backbone.js makes it easier to manage dynamic changes in the UI. Views can listen to changes in models and update themselves automatically, providing a more responsive user experience.
7. Community and Documentation
Backbone.js has a strong developer community and rich documentation. Despite being an older framework, it continues to be supported and used in legacy systems and even some modern applications.
8. Perfect for Micro Frontends and Legacy Modernization
Backbone.js excels in micro frontend development due to its modularity. It is lightweight enough to embed into different parts of a larger application and still maintain performance and scalability. This is especially useful for enterprises migrating legacy systems in phases.
Real-World Use Cases of Backbone.js
Backbone.js has been used in a variety of successful applications. Major companies like Trello, SoundCloud, and Airbnb have incorporated Backbone.js in parts of their technology stack. These examples show that even in a landscape dominated by newer frameworks, Backbone.js continues to play a vital role.
1. Trello
Trello, a popular project management tool, relies heavily on Backbone.js for its dynamic card and board functionalities. The MVC structure of Backbone.js helps manage complex interactions between tasks, lists, and users.
2. Airbnb
Airbnb initially used Backbone.js for parts of its frontend architecture. The flexibility of the framework allowed their developers to tailor solutions according to their growing product needs.
3. SoundCloud
SoundCloud used Backbone.js in its mobile web interface, where lightweight and fast performance is critical. Backbone's minimal footprint was a perfect match for their needs.
